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Spark Real Conversation
Feeling stuck on what to say is normal. Start with low-pressure, adaptable openers that show you read their profile and invite a short reply. Use these patterns as templates—swap in specific details from their photos or bio so your message feels personal, not copy-pasted.
Quick opener patterns you can customize
- Observation + question: "I noticed your hiking photo—what trail was that?"
- Two-choice prompt: "Coffee or tea on a rainy afternoon—what’s your pick?"
- Genuine curiosity: "You mentioned volunteering—what’s one project you loved working on?"
- Light callback to their bio: "You said you’re learning guitar—what song are you trying right now?"
- Playful, low-stakes challenge: "I bet I can guess your go-to pizza topping in three tries—want to play?"
How to avoid sounding boring or awkward
- Reference something specific instead of "Hey" or "Nice profile." It shows attention without pressure.
- Skip generic compliments like "You’re beautiful" on their own. If you compliment, pair it with a fact: "Great smile—was that taken at a concert?"
- Avoid heavy or overly personal questions first. Save deep topics for when rapport builds.
- Keep the first message short—one to three sentences is usually enough to invite a reply.
Follow-up moves that keep the chat flowing
- If they answer a question: Acknowledge and add a small fact about yourself: "That trail sounds amazing—I love trails with views. I went to [shortcut detail] last summer."
- If they give a short reply: Try a playful expansion: "Nice—that’s my second favorite too. What made it your top pick?"
- If they don’t reply: Send one friendly, different-angle message after a few days—no pressure: "Hey, thought of you when I saw [related thing]. How’s your week?"
Short checklist before you hit send
- Personalize with a detail from their profile.
- Keep it concise and question-based.
- Stay friendly and avoid heavy topics.
- Don’t over-edit—authentic beats perfect.
